Nathan Atkinson from Tyler, TX (12/12/2011)
"Fun, fast course and great support stations" (about: 2011)

4-5 previous marathons | 1 Bryan/College Station Marathon
COURSE: 5  ORGANIZATION: 4  FANS: 4


This was a great race. The course was fun and fast. I loved running thru the campus near the end. Water/gatorade stations were timed well at 1.5 miles and always well staffed. Gummy Bear stations were also very nice! The crowds were smaller than races like White Rock and no bands along the course, but those that were out were very supportive. This was the first year, so I expect that to grow. The swag of a short-sleeve tech shirt and running hat were nice and the medal was really nice. Compare that to 2 long-sleeve shirts (one cotton and one tech 'finisher' shirt) from a race like White Rock. I prefer the 2 long-sleeve but no real complaint there. After race food & drink was nice. The weather was really good so staying outside wasn't bad. I could see where that could be problematic if the weather is bad one year like White Rock was this year. Having access to a shelter like White Rock has in Fair Park would be nice. It would also be great to start developing a pre-race expo if possible.

In a great college town that has needed a race like this for a long time, finally B/CS gets its marathon. It was a great first year. The organizers really did well with the course and the on-course support, which is what really counts when you're out there for 26.2! I plan to do this race again next year and only expect things to improve as it grows from year to year.

J. R. from Richmond, Texas (12/12/2011)
"Great medical staff, thanks for getting me thru it" (about: 2011)

4-5 previous marathons | 1 Bryan/College Station Marathon
COURSE: 5  ORGANIZATION: 5  FANS: 3


Enjoyed the course, having grown up as a runner in college station, was nice to have course go through Thomas Park, my pm runs in high school, Villa Marie, part of 10 mile loop from campus in college, Central Park, former site of Consol Invite. Most medical i've seen at a race, plenty of med stations along the way, loved the salty gatorade which I think helped me get through the last 3 miles with cramps. Maybe next year provide seating area to enjoy the beer and BBQ.
